Our course provides essential knowledge for supervisors and managers regarding DOT “Reasonable Suspicion” Testing for alcohol and drug abuse. After finishing the course, participants should:
- Be able to identify the “behavioral” and “physical” symptoms of alcohol consumption.
- Learn the right way to approach an employee targeted for “Reasonable Suspicion” testing.
- Comprehend the process of conducting drug and alcohol tests.
- Grasp the protocol for “Removal-From-Work” and the “Return-To-Duty” process.
- Be aware of the resources available for employees struggling with substance abuse.
